> I work at a ginormous company that has a proxy server. I have an active
> {{<proxy>}} in my {{.m2/settings.xml}} for the {{http}} protocol. The
> {{maven-javadoc-plugin}} picks this up fine.
> Weirdly, the {{javadoc}} invocation _also_ requires the {{https}} proxy to be
> set. There is no way to accomplish this with the {{maven-javadoc-plugin}}.
> IMHO it should see if there is an active {{<proxy>}} element whose protocol
> is {{https}} as well.
